1. Home
  2. Missouri
  3. Saint Louis

American Title Loan's Location On Map

320 South Florissant Road,
Saint Louis, MO - 63135
314-524-2702

We can you Detailed route from your location to American Title Loan 320 South Florissant Road Saint Louis Missouri 63135 on google maps with traffic summary on map.



Used Cars Dealers Near American Title Loan
Custom Cruisers Sales Service & Detailing - Inventory,
13580 Tesson Ferry Road
Saint Louis
McMahon Ford Company - Inventory,
3345 South Kingshighway Boulevard
Saint Louis
JW Autosales - Inventory,
3115 Gravois Avenue
Saint Louis
Enterprise Rent A Car - Inventory,
10638 New Halls Ferry Rd
Saint Louis
Mack Trucks by F & C Truck Sales - Inventory,
2350 Chouteau Avenue
Saint Louis